Article Overview
This article summarizes a CMS proposal in the CY 2016 OPPS proposed rule that would change how laboratory tests are reported and paid on outpatient claims. It is relevant to hospital outpatient departments, coding and billing staff, and compliance teams that handle CLFS-related claims processing, modifier reporting, and lab payment policy updates. The discussion also covers proposed treatment of molecular pathology services and preventive laboratory tests.
Why This Topic Matters
The proposal could affect claim reporting workflow, administrative burden, and how certain laboratory services are handled for separate payment in outpatient settings. It is important for organizations that submit multi-service or multi-day hospital outpatient claims and need to track policy changes affecting lab payment and claim editing.
